7//! # Service Identification
8//!
9//! This module provides the [`Service`] model, detailing network services
10//! and their specific implementation details. It supports progressive
11//! fingerprinting, allowing low-confidence guesses to be upgraded as
12//! deeper script and protocol analysis finishes.
13
14/// Information about a detected service on a network port.
15#[derive(Debug, Clone, PartialEq, Eq)]
16pub struct Service {
17 /// The high-level service protocol name (e.g., "ssh", "http", "postgresql").
18 name: String,
19
20 /// A metric from 0 to 100 representing the certainty of this identification.
21 ///
22 /// For example: `0` = Table lookup by port number. `100` = Full protocol handshake.
23 confidence: u8,
24
25 /// The specific product or daemon name (e.g., "OpenSSH", "nginx").
26 product: Option<String>,
27
28 /// The version string reported or detected (e.g., "8.9p1", "1.21.0").
29 version: Option<String>,
30
31 /// Additional metadata or environment hints (e.g., "protocol 2.0", "Debian").
32 extrainfo: Option<String>,
33
34 /// A list of Common Platform Enumeration (CPE) identifiers.
35 cpe: Vec<String>,
36}
37
38impl Service {
39 /// Creates a new service record with a baseline confidence score.
40 ///
41 /// Creates a new service identity.
42 ///
43 /// The `confidence` value is clamped to a maximum of 100.
44 pub fn new(name: impl Into<String>, confidence: u8) -> Self {
45 Self {
46 name: name.into(),
47 confidence: confidence.min(100),
48 product: None,
49 version: None,
50 extrainfo: None,
51 cpe: Vec::new(),
52 }
53 }
54
55 /// Returns the high-level service protocol name.
56 pub fn name(&self) -> &str {
57 &self.name
58 }
59
60 /// Returns the identification confidence score (0-100).
61 pub fn confidence(&self) -> u8 {
62 self.confidence
63 }
64
65 /// Returns the detected product name, if any.
66 pub fn product(&self) -> Option<&str> {
67 self.product.as_deref()
68 }
69
70 /// Returns the detected version string, if any.
71 pub fn version(&self) -> Option<&str> {
72 self.version.as_deref()
73 }
74
75 /// Returns additional environmental metadata, if any.
76 pub fn extrainfo(&self) -> Option<&str> {
77 self.extrainfo.as_deref()
78 }
79
80 /// Returns the list of CPE identifiers.
81 pub fn cpe(&self) -> &[String] {
82 &self.cpe
83 }
84
85 /// Builder method to assign a product string.
86 pub fn with_product(mut self, product: impl Into<String>) -> Self {
87 self.product = Some(product.into());
88 self
89 }
90
91 /// Builder method to assign a version string.
92 pub fn with_version(mut self, version: impl Into<String>) -> Self {
93 self.version = Some(version.into());
94 self
95 }
96
97 /// Builder method to add a single CPE identifier.
98 pub fn add_cpe(mut self, cpe: impl Into<String>) -> Self {
99 let cpe_str = cpe.into();
100 if !self.cpe.contains(&cpe_str) {
101 self.cpe.push(cpe_str);
102 }
103 self
104 }
105
106 /// Merges another service record into this one safely.
107 ///
108 /// The merge strategy is confidence-driven. If the incoming `other` service
109 /// has a strictly higher confidence score, it will overwrite the primary
110 /// identity (`name`, `product`, `version`). Otherwise, it behaves additively,
111 /// filling in `None` fields and deduplicating CPEs.
112 pub fn merge(&mut self, other: Service) {
113 let higher_confidence = other.confidence > self.confidence;
114
115 if higher_confidence {
116 self.name = other.name;
117 self.confidence = other.confidence;
118
119 // Overwrite existing data with the higher-confidence payload
120 if other.product.is_some() {
121 self.product = other.product;
122 }
123 if other.version.is_some() {
124 self.version = other.version;
125 }
126 if other.extrainfo.is_some() {
127 self.extrainfo = other.extrainfo;
128 }
129 } else {
130 // Additive merge for equal or lower confidence probes
131 if self.product.is_none() {
132 self.product = other.product;
133 }
134 if self.version.is_none() {
135 self.version = other.version;
136 }
137 if self.extrainfo.is_none() {
138 self.extrainfo = other.extrainfo;
139 }
140 }
141
142 // CPEs are always merged and deduplicated, regardless of confidence.
143 // Even a low-confidence probe might extract a valid CPE string.
144 for c in other.cpe {
145 if !self.cpe.contains(&c) {
146 self.cpe.push(c);
147 }
148 }
149 }
150}

161#[cfg(test)]
162mod tests {
163 use super::*;
164
165 #[test]
166 fn service_builder_pattern() {
167 let srv = Service::new("http", 85)
168 .with_product("nginx")
169 .with_version("1.21.0")
170 .add_cpe("cpe:/a:igor_sysoev:nginx:1.21.0");
171
172 assert_eq!(srv.name(), "http");
173 assert_eq!(srv.confidence(), 85);
174 assert_eq!(srv.product(), Some("nginx"));
175 assert_eq!(srv.version(), Some("1.21.0"));
176 assert_eq!(srv.cpe().len(), 1);
177 }
178
179 #[test]
180 fn service_confidence_is_clamped_to_100() {
181 let srv = Service::new("ssh", 101);
182 assert_eq!(srv.confidence(), 100);
183 }
184
185 #[test]
186 fn service_merge_lower_confidence_does_not_overwrite_identity() {
187 let mut srv1 = Service::new("http", 85).with_product("nginx");
188 let srv2 = Service::new("unknown", 10).with_version("2.0");
189
190 srv1.merge(srv2);
191
192 // Name and product shouldn't change, but version should be adopted from lower confidence
193 // if not already present.
194 assert_eq!(srv1.name(), "http");
195 assert_eq!(srv1.confidence(), 85);
196 assert_eq!(srv1.product(), Some("nginx"));
197 assert_eq!(srv1.version(), Some("2.0"));
198 }
199
200 #[test]
201 fn service_merge_higher_confidence_overwrites_identity() {
202 let mut srv1 = Service::new("http", 50).with_product("nginx");
203 let srv2 = Service::new("http", 100)
204 .with_product("Apache")
205 .with_version("2.4");
206
207 srv1.merge(srv2);
208
209 // The higher confidence payload completely overwrites the identity
210 assert_eq!(srv1.name(), "http");
211 assert_eq!(srv1.confidence(), 100);
212 assert_eq!(srv1.product(), Some("Apache"));
213 assert_eq!(srv1.version(), Some("2.4"));
214 }
215
216 #[test]
217 fn service_merge_deduplicates_cpes() {
218 let mut srv1 = Service::new("ssh", 100).add_cpe("cpe:/a:openbsd:openssh");
219 let srv2 = Service::new("ssh", 100).add_cpe("cpe:/o:linux:linux_kernel");
220
221 srv1.merge(srv2);
222
223 assert_eq!(srv1.cpe().len(), 2);
224 }
225}
